ExPay says it offers gambling and betting payment processing in Turkey and Kyrgyzstan, with settlement in USDT

ExPay is pitching seven years in the market, its own processing stack with direct bank channels, and a fallback cascade for gambling and betting flows in Turkey and Kyrgyzstan. For PSPs and operators, the relevant bit is not the sales copy; it is the payment rails, the settlement currency, the ticket sizes, and the fact that refund, chargeback, and rolling reserve are listed as absent.

  1. Turkey: ExPay lists Bank Transfer (HAVALE P2P) for pay-in and pay-out. Pay-in limits are 500–100 000 TRY, with pay-in from 250 available for large, stable volumes; pay-out limits are 2 000–100 000 TRY. Settlement is in USDT, T+0.
  2. Kyrgyzstan: the company offers local P2P methods including ELQR P2P, transfer by phone number, and P2P Mbank via Visa / Mastercard / Elkart. Pay-in limits are 300–150 000 KGS and pay-out limits are 1 000–250 000 KGS, with settlement in USDT, T+1.
  3. Scope and integration: ExPay says it works with gambling and betting traffic, supports FTD + STD traffic, and offers H2H / Redirect integration. It also says support is available 24/7, with fast launch and testing.
  4. Risk and commercial structure: the offer explicitly says refund, chargeback, and RR are absent. For high-risk merchants, that is the real commercial headline, because it changes how much back-end friction and balance-sheet exposure a provider says it will carry.
  5. Other geographies: ExPay also lists Azerbaijan, Uzbekistan, Korea, Argentina, and Europe as available geos, without additional routing details in the source.
